The Freeride World Tour (FWT) starts its 13th season. From a summit in Japan, skiers and snowboarders will go on a hunt for points in 2020. This year's final event is a historical winter sports jubilee at the place of longing of the freeriders at Verbier, Switzerland...
The calendar for the Freeride World Tour (FWT) 2020 is fixed. Not much has changed: The tour stops of the world-class athletes will take place at the same locations as last year. The freeriders start on steep powder slopes in Asia, North America, and Europe, where the tour ends in Andorra, Austria, and Switzerland.
Since 2008, the Freeride World Tour has been hosting annual world championships for freeride skiers and snowboarders. Most recently, Markus Eder and Arianna Tricomi from Italy won the World Championships for skiers and Victor de la Rue as well as Marion Haerty from France for snowboarders.
2020 Freeride World Tour: Full Schedule Calendar, dates.
Date Location
18-25 January 2020 Hakuba, Japan
6-12 February 2020 Kicking Horse, Golden, BC, Canada
28 February-4 March 2020 Ordino-ArcalÃs, Andorra
7-13 March 2020 Fieberbrunn, Austria
28 March - 5 April 2020 Verbier, Switzerland
